Task 2: Some school leavers travel or work for a period of time instead of going directly to the university. What are the advantages or disadvantages of their study?

In recent years, it has been increasingly common to see various high school students take a gap year off before going to academic institutions. This trend would create certain benefits but there will also be several drawbacks.
On the one hand, taking some time off to travel and work before starting university life has several noteworthy advantages effects. The primary benefit is that high school leavers might be dedicated to traveling and new experiences, which enables them to explore their fields of interest to make wise educational decisions. For instance, a plethora of organizations and projects are established to welcome those who utterly want to attend to develop life skills and integrate into society, regardless of age, location, ability, and background. Besides, those taking a year off can enjoy an advantage over their peers with problem-solving and task management skills, which might be ameliorated through such experiences. An additional positive is that a vacation allows students to discover a different culture and meet new hospitable individuals. In particular, it is by traveling school leavers are possible to know diverse traditional costumes, customs, traditional foods, etc and communicate with others in adverse languages.
Despite these aforementioned benefits, several drawbacks do exist. The serious disadvantage of spending a year off is that it may discourage students from continuing their study back. Consequently, they almost lack the motivation and element of competition when studying in college or university, and even their ability to work in a face-to-face group can be greatly decreased. For example, various students have a tendency to spend more time alone to relax after the challenging period with tests and exams so that they will become apprehensive and shy if they commence studying in institutions. Furthermore, a great number of students are finding the work environment more financially appealing and less strenuous, as opposed to having to encounter high expectations and pressure in assignments. Because of this, fewer high school leavers these days are likely to have a job or pursue their passion than continuing for higher education. Additionally, the poor cannot afford to pay tuition fees for the universities while the ordinary family or affluent family has enough budget to pay for institution’s fees and other extracurricular activities for their children.
In conclusion, despite the disadvantage relating to educational interruption, I strongly believe that the advantage in terms of academic orientation and skill development is more crucial. Therefore, high school students should be encouraged if they wish.
